Considering the product-process matrix, which process type is the most flexible and creates products with the lowest level of standardization?

  

Manufacturing Cell

  

Work Center

  

Continuous Process

  

Project

Answer #1

Project has the lowest level of standardization where each time the processes are set-up and customized for the output. Systems are equipment are can be arranged from the scratch for a project. Hence the answer

Manufacturing Cell and Work Center have some level of standardization since the facilities and equipment are permanent and have own limitations

Continuous process is highly standardized
